The traditional materials science tetrahedron emphasizes... NettetThe classic “fire triangle” can be visualized as an and gate. For a fire to exist three conditions must be met: 1. Fuel above its flash point must be present. 2. Oxygen (usually as a component of air) must be present. 3. An ignition source such as an open flame or hot surface must exist. five onion dip miss brown

Internal Forces in Beams and Frames. 4.1 Introduction. When a beam or frame is subjected to transverse loadings, the three possible internal forces that are developed are the normal or axial force, the shearing force, and the bending moment, as shown in section k of the cantilever of Figure 4.1.
